Output 0f16084e921c7ffe0278225349910c862112d35a717bb8a8a059465512569b6e:0

value
34421000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b389bce60873bdc0b188d35d75e5c5cbbab576 OP_EQUAL
address
MAhVahweXhQX36HoYJq1F96Wqp7insfb4a
transaction
0f16084e921c7ffe0278225349910c862112d35a717bb8a8a059465512569b6e
spent
true